Avalanche Activity

Slab avalanches and wet avalanches during the day are the main danger, in particular at low and intermediate altitudes.

Over a wide area 30 to 40 cm of snow fell on Sunday above approximately 1500 m. The northerly wind will transport the new snow. The fresh snow and in particular the wind slabs can be released easily, or, in isolated cases naturally. Remotely triggered avalanches are possible. In addition as the day progresses at low and intermediate altitudes, numerous moist and wet avalanches are to be expected. Ski touring and other off-piste activities, including snowshoe hiking, call for defensive route selection.

Snowpack Structure

Towards its surface, the snowpack is unfavourably layered. Sunshine and high temperatures will give rise as the day progresses to rapid moistening of the snowpack in particular on sunny slopes below approximately 2400 m. Especially steep shady slopes high altitudes and the high Alpine regions: Weak layers exist in the old snowpack here. Adjacent to ridgelines and in pass areas as well as at high altitude snow depths vary greatly, depending on the infuence of the wind.

Tendency

The danger of dry avalanches will decrease gradually. Increase in danger of moist and wet avalanches as a consequence of warming during the day and solar radiation.
